当前位置:首页 > 行业动态 > 正文

服务器正常关机流程是怎样的?

服务器正常关机流程包括保存工作、关闭应用程序、通知用户、执行系统关机命令、断开电源或进入待机状态。

服务器的正常关机流程是确保数据完整性、系统稳定性及硬件健康的重要步骤,一个规范的关机流程不仅能避免数据丢失,还能延长服务器的使用寿命,本文将详细介绍服务器正常关机的标准流程,包括前期准备、执行步骤以及后续检查。

服务器正常关机流程是怎样的?  第1张

前期准备

在进行服务器关机之前,需要完成以下准备工作:

1、通知相关人员:提前通知所有可能受到影响的用户和运维团队,确保他们有足够的时间做好相应准备。

2、备份重要数据:对关键数据进行备份,以防万一出现意外情况导致数据丢失。

3、检查依赖服务:确认是否有其他依赖于该服务器运行的服务或应用,并评估这些服务在服务器关闭期间的影响。

4、更新文档记录:记录下此次关机的原因、预计时间和任何特殊注意事项。

执行步骤

步骤一:停止非必要服务

逐一关闭不需要继续运行的服务,如Web服务器、数据库等。

使用systemctl stop <service_name>命令来安全地停止每个服务。

确保所有正在处理的任务都已完成后再继续下一步。

步骤二:注销用户会话

通过who命令查看当前登录到系统的用户列表。

对于每个活跃的会话,尝试联系用户并请求其主动退出;如果无法联系上,则强制断开连接。

pkill -KILL -u username可以用来终止特定用户的进程。

步骤三:同步文件系统

执行sync命令以确保所有缓存中的数据被写入磁盘。

这一步非常重要,因为它可以防止因突然断电而导致的数据损坏。

步骤四:关闭操作系统

根据操作系统的不同,选择合适的命令来进行关机操作。

对于Linux系统,可以使用shutdown -h now或者poweroff。

Windows服务器则可以通过开始菜单选择“关机”,或者使用shutdown /s /t 0命令立即关机。

步骤五:切断电源(仅针对物理机)

如果是直接操作物理服务器,在操作系统完全关闭后还需要手动断开电源供应器。

请务必等待至少几分钟后再拔掉插头,给内部组件足够的冷却时间。

后续检查

即使完成了上述所有步骤,也建议在下次启动时做一次全面检查:

硬件状态:检查CPU温度、风扇转速等指标是否正常。

软件环境:验证关键应用程序和服务是否能够顺利重启并恢复正常工作。

日志审查:查阅系统日志文件中的相关信息,寻找可能存在的警告或错误消息。

FAQs

Q1: 如果服务器在关机过程中卡住了怎么办?

A1: 首先尝试通过SSH或其他远程管理工具重新连接服务器并尝试手动发送关机信号,如果仍然没有响应,则可以考虑使用IPMI接口远程重启服务器,最坏情况下可能需要现场干预,但在此之前请尽量采取非侵入式的方法解决问题。

Q2: 如何快速判断服务器是否已经完全关机?

A2: 你可以通过观察指示灯的变化来判断(例如电源按钮旁边的LED灯),还可以利用网络监控工具检测目标IP地址是否已从网络上消失,直接前往机房查看也是一种可靠的方法,不过需要注意的是,频繁地开关机可能会对硬盘造成损害,因此除非必要否则应尽量避免这种做法。

以上就是关于“服务器正常关机流程”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!

0